Walnut (Juglans regia L.) is both an elite economic species and one of the important nut. It has long cultivated history and widely distributed in our country. But the conventional breeding limits the rapid expansion and extension for elite walnut variety for long breeding cycle ,low propagation coefficient and low survival rate.Stock cultivating, nurse seed grafting, methods to improve the micro-grafting's survival rate and scion cultivating methods was researched in this article.The major improvement and innovation was that great breakthrough has been achieved in major technology.The main results were as follow:1. Comparative tests of shoots stock cultivation methodsCurrently, Cultivating a walnut grafted seedlings costs at least 2 years, and even 3 or 4 years. As rootstock, the One-year-old seedling is not able to meet the grafting demands.while our experiments showed that the walnut grafted seedlings to be seedling-selling only in 1 year.The results were as follow: Peat and perlite (1:1) with sand and mushroom residue (1:1) was the appropriate matrix which cultivated walnut rootstock shoots. The walnut germinated quickly, grew fast and was conducive to grafting; grafting rate was above 70% in late May.Arch Shed enhanced the sprouting of walnut seeds which seedlings were the largest and most conducive to grafting, grafting rate was 71.33%. The growth of seeds sowing in autumn was significantly improved. The earlier the seeds sowed in autumn the better the growth of seedlings, which would favor the grafting next summer.2. Study on nurse seed grafting methods of Juglans regiaThe paper used the tender scion cleft-grafting,the modified square budding grafting and bud grafting with xylem. The grafting survival rates were respectively 95.00%, 86.67% and 63.33% and the scion's yearly increments were respectively 48.78cm, 38.59cm and 35.93cm. The walnut tender scion cleft-grafting was superior to others. Because three grafting methods used the buds had different location on the scion. So the three methods can be used in practice at the same time to make a full use of the scion. The study made it feasible to be seedlings after grafting one year.3. Study on improving the micro-grafting survival rateThe tests of different growth regulators showed that the graft survival rate was 56.69% the highest which soaked scion in the solution with 6-BA 1.0mg·L-1and IBA0.1mg L-1. The test of conserving the scion at different temperatures and moisture showed that the Survival Rate was 50.00 % the highest when the scion fully embedded and only keep top of the scion out at the temperature of 26-28℃. The tests of the infection of different culture environment on the graft survival rate showed that suitable training environment of grafted seedlings was that on the incubator, relative humidity was above 95% , the temperature was 28±2℃, light was 16h·d-1, light intensity was 18001x, then moved the grafted seedlings in the incubator with relative moisture 60-70% after 5 days. The other conditions kept the same. The survival rate was up to 46.65 %; the test with Different training time of seedlings showed that graft survival rate was highest 53.35% when training the plantlet 6 days.4. Study on cultivation of improved variety scionThe test of one-year-old grafted seedlings showed that the method of pruning 1/4 of the seedlings was the best; The test of Tissue culture cultivation breeding varieties scion showed that the bud reproduction capabilities in tissue culture were in great differences, with the coefficient of 3.11 in three months while training breeding improved scion's propagation coefficient was 4.17 in three months.
